Cushman & Wakefield’s New England Multifamily Advisory Group is pleased to offer for sale 431-439 Hanover Street, a five-story, sixteen (16) unit mixed use apartment and retail building located in Boston’s historic North End. 431-439 Hanover Street presents a rare opportunity to acquire a stabilized, income-producing asset at the very heart of Boston’s historic North End – a district that has emerged as both a premier residential neighborhood and a destination dining and cultural corridor.
431-439 Hanover Street is an opportunity to acquire an irreplaceable property that offers a combination of stable cash flow and upsides. Through strategic reconfiguration and renovation of units (including additional bedrooms), repositioning of the commercial and/or executing a condominium exit strategy, the property offers a variety of value-creation opportunities. While the building has maintained 100% occupancy, there is a distinct opportunity to add bedrooms and upgrade interiors, including kitchens, bathrooms, flooring, lighting and appliances. Following the upgrades, the incoming buyer would elevate the competitive profile of the asset and the renovated units would command significantly higher rents, or be poised for condominium conversion.
The history and architecture of the North End is unmistakable. Settled in the early 1600s, it is the oldest neighborhood of Boston, known for its Italian heritage, feasts, and unmistakable proximity to Boston Harbor and downtown. Blending well with the family-owned Italian enclaves, urban life exemplifies the neighborhood with a thriving bar scene, trendy restaurants and open parks. The Boston Public Market, Rose Kennedy Greenway, and Haymarket are proximate and enhance the neighborhood as a high-demand residential neighborhood and top tourist destination. Positioned to benefit from the old charm and new amenities, the North End is a practical and popular neighborhood for those commuting by foot to downtown Boston’s Financial District. It is also easily accessible via the MBTA, Water Taxis, the Mass Pike (I-90), and I-93. 431-439 Hanover Street presents an unsurpassed opportunity to purchase a legacy apartment building in Boston’s North End.
431-439 Hanover Street is offered for sale on an "as-is" basis and without a formal asking price. Once investors have had an opportunity to review the offering materials and tour the property, Cushman & Wakefield will schedule a "Call for Offers" date.
